What Is a Black and Decker Toaster Oven?
A Black and Decker Toaster Oven is a countertop appliance designed to handle a variety of cooking tasks in a space-saving package. Unlike a basic toaster, which is limited to browning bread, these toaster ovens offer multiple functions, including toasting, baking, broiling, and often convection cooking.
Available in various sizes, from compact models for small kitchens to larger units for families, Black and Decker toaster ovens are known for their user-friendly designs and consistent performance.

Key Features of a B&D Toaster Oven
When shopping for a Black and Decker toaster oven, you’ll find a range of models with features tailored to different needs. Here’s what to look for:

- Capacity Options
Black and Decker offers toaster ovens in various sizes, from compact units that toast four slices of bread to larger models that fit a 9-inch pizza or small casserole dish. Choose based on your cooking needs and available space. - Multiple Cooking Modes
Most Black and Decker toaster ovens include settings for toasting, baking, and broiling. Higher-end models may feature convection technology, which circulates hot air for faster, more even cooking, or air-fry capabilities for crispy results with less oil. - Adjustable Temperature and Timer
Precise control is key to great cooking. A Black and Decker oven typically offers adjustable temperature settings and a built-in timer, often with an auto-shutoff feature for safety. - Easy-to-Clean Design
Many models come with a removable crumb tray and non-stick interior, making cleanup quick and hassle-free. This is a lifesaver after cooking cheesy dishes or greasy snacks. - Accessories Included
Depending on the model, your Black and Decker oven may come with a baking pan, broil rack, or air-fry basket, adding value and versatility right out of the box.

Tips for Maximizing Toaster Oven
To get the most out of your Black and Decker toaster oven, follow these practical tips:
- Preheat for Best Results
Preheating ensures even cooking, especially for baking or roasting. Most models take just a few minutes to reach the desired temperature. - Use Appropriate Cookware
Invest in small, oven-safe dishes that fit your toaster oven. Mini baking sheets, ramekins, and silicone molds are great for a variety of recipes. - Don’t Overcrowd
For optimal heat circulation, avoid packing the oven too tightly. Cook in batches if needed, especially for air frying or toasting. - Clean Regularly
Wipe down the interior and empty the crumb tray after each use to prevent buildup. This keeps your Black and Decker toaster oven performing like new. - Explore Recipes
